Guralnik, Tame Ahmed, Eatriz E Alvarado, Susa P Phillips, Nicole Rosendaal, Carmen Lucia Curcio, Juliana Fernandes, Maria Victoria ZunzuneguiAbstract:Abstract Objectives To examine differences in incidence of functional Disability between older women and men. Methods 2002 participants (65–74 years) were recruited in 2012 from Canada, Brazil, Colombia, and Albania, and re-assessed in 2016. Three measures of functional Disability were used (1) Difficulty in any of five mobility-related Activities of Daily Living (ADL Disability); (2) Self-reported difficulty climbing a flight of stairs or walking 400 m (mobility Disability); and (3) Poor physical performance. We estimated the adjusted gender-specific incidence risk ratios (IRR) for each outcome in 2016. Results In 2016, 1506 participants (52% women) were re-examined, 80% of the surviving cohort. Among those not disabled in 2012, seventy-four (12.9%) men developed ADL Disability, while 105 (19.2%) developed mobility Disability, and 97 (16.1%) developed poor physical performance. For women, numbers were higher 120 (21.4%) developed ADL Disability, 117 (26.5%) developed mobility Disability, and 140 (23.0%) developed poor physical performance. Compared to men, women had a higher adjusted incidence of self-reported ADL Disability (IRR 1.4; 95% CI 1.04–1.88) and mobility Disability (IRR 1.4; 95% CI 1.06–1.77), but not of poor physical performance (IRR 1.03; 95% CI 0.88–1.32). Conclusions Although women have a higher self-reported incidence of ADL and mobility Disability than men, there was no significant difference in poor physical performance. Reasons for this discrepancy between self-reported and performance-based measures require further investigation. Understanding gender differences in functional disabilities can provide the basis for interventions to prevent mobility loss and minimize any gender gap.

Guralnik, Cynthia M Boyd, Qian Li Xue, Bruce Leff, Jennifer L Wolff, Elizabeth K Tanner, Roland J Thorpe, David Bishai, Laura N GitlinAbstract:Importance Disability among older adults is a strong predictor of health outcomes, health service use, and health care costs. Few interventions have reduced Disability among older adults. Objective To determine whether a 10-session, home-based, multidisciplinary program reduces Disability. Design, Setting, and Participants In this randomized clinical trial of 300 low-income community-dwelling adults with a Disability in Baltimore, Maryland, between March 18, 2012, and April 29, 2016, 65 years or older, cognitively intact, and with self-reported difficulty with 1 or more activities of daily living (ADLs) or 2 or more instrumental ADLs (IADLs), participants were interviewed in their home at baseline, 5 months (end point), and 12 months (follow-up) by trained research assistants who were masked to the group allocation. Participants were randomized to either the intervention (CAPABLE) group (n = 152) or the attention control group (n = 148) through a computer-based assignment scheme, stratified by sex in randomized blocks. Intention-to-treat analysis was used to assess the intervention. Data were analyzed from September 2017 through August 2018. Interventions The CAPABLE group received up to 10 home visits over 5 months by occupational therapists, registered nurses, and home modifiers to address self-identified functional goals by enhancing individual capacity and the home environment. The control group received 10 social home visits by a research assistant. Main Outcomes and Measures Disability with ADLs or IADLs at 5 months. Each ADL and IADL task was self-scored from 0 to 2 according to whether in the previous month the person did not have difficulty and did not need help (0), did not need help but had difficulty (1), or needed help regardless of difficulty (2). The overall score ranged from 0 to 16 points. Results Of the 300 people randomized to either the CAPABLE group (n = 152) or the control group (n = 148), 133 of the CAPABLE participants (87.5%) were women with a mean (SD) age of 75.7 (7.6) years; 126 (82.9%) self-identified as black. Of the controls, 129 (87.2%) were women with a mean (SD) age of 75.4 (7.4) years; 133 (89.9%) self-identified as black. CAPABLE participation resulted in 30% reduction in ADL Disability scores at 5 months (relative risk [RR], 0.70; 95% CI, 0.54-0.93;P = .01) vs control participation. CAPABLE participation resulted in a statistically nonsignificant 17% reduction in IADL Disability scores (RR, 0.83; 95% CI, 0.65-1.06;P = .13) vs control participation. Participants in the CAPABLE group vs those in the control group were more likely to report that the program made their life easier (82.3% vs 43.1%;P Conclusions and Relevance Low-income community-dwelling older adults who received the CAPABLE intervention experienced substantial decrease in Disability; Disability may be modifiable through addressing both the person and the environment. Guralnik, Amani Nurujeter, Meredith MinklerAbstract:THE 1990s saw the continuation of a slow but steady decline in Disability rates among older Americans (1,2). This decline was confirmed by numerous studies (3–5) and documented in an influential systematic review, which showed an annual Disability decline of 1–1.5% from the late 1980s through the 1990s (1). The falling rates were driven primarily by declines in limitations in instrumental activities of daily living (e.g., difficulties in shopping and cleaning) and functional limitations (e.g., difficulty reaching, bending, and/or stooping), which fell substantially during this period (2). Although findings on trends in limitations in basic activities of daily living (ADL) disabilities (e.g., bathing, dressing, and getting around inside the home) were much less consistent, a National Institute on Aging consensus panel concluded that there were declines of between 1% and 2.5% annually in ADL limitations in the population aged 70 and older during the mid- and late 1990s (2). In an updated examination of trends in Disability through 2005, Manton et al. (6) concluded that the declining trends in Disability observed in the 1990s continued and, in fact, accelerated between 1999 and 2004–2005. During this latter period, they reported that chronic Disability, a combined measure of ADL and instrumental ADL limitations, declined 2.2% per annum. Accurately monitoring changes in Disability rates is critical, both in the context of the anticipated doubling of the older population between 2000 and 2030 (7) and because Disability is considered “a better predictor of medical and social service need than simple prevalence or incidence figures of disease.” (8) In this study, we examine trends in basic ADL disabilities and functional limitations among older adults from 2000 to 2005 using the American Community Survey (ACS), the largest nationally representative survey of community-dwelling elderly adults (response rates >93%), and the 2004 National Nursing Home Survey (NNHS). By examining basic ADL disabilities and functional limitations separately, we can better examine the differences and similarities in these trends than a combined chronic disease measure allows.

GuralnikAbstract:Background and aims: To examine the impact of new Disability on the incidence of depressive symptoms, with 3-year biannual data from The Woman’s Health and Aging Study. Methods: Subjects (n=671) were selected if they were independent at baseline in 5 basic activities of daily living (ADLs) and were not depressed [scored <14 on the Geriatric Depression Scale (GDS; range 0 to 30)]. During the follow-ups, worsening of ADL Disability (needed help on an increased number of ADLs) and onset of depressive symptoms (GDS score ≥14) were defined. For each pair of consecutive interviews in which depressive symptoms were not present in the first interview in the pair, we assessed incidence of worsening Disability and depressive symptoms in the second interview of the pair. We also summarized the incidence of depressive symptoms 6 months later among the people who did not develop depressive symptoms at the time they reported a new Disability. Results: Compared with those not developing Disability, after adjusting for demographic characteristics, number of diseases, and ADL difficulty level at the moment of onset of the Disability, the odds ratio (OR) for developing depressive symptoms at Disability onset was 2.2 (95% Confidence Interval (CI) 1.1–4.3). For those developing new Disability without depressive symptoms, the adjusted OR for developing depressive symptoms 6 months later was 1.7 (CI 0.6–4.8). Conclusion: Onset of new Disability in basic ADLs had a significant impact on the development of depressive symptoms at the moment of onset. Our results demonstrate that clinicians should carefully evaluate depressive symptoms in patients with new onset of Disability.

FriedAbstract:Background "Frailty" is an adverse, primarily gerontologic, health condition regarded as frequent with aging and having severe consequences. Although clinicians claim that the extremes of frailty can be easily recognized, a standardized definition of frailty has proved elusive until recently. This article evaluates the cross-validity, criterion validity, and internal validity in the Women's Health and Aging Studies (WHAS) of a discrete measure of frailty recently validated in the Cardiovascular Health Study (CHS). Methods The frailty measure developed in CHS was delineated in the WHAS data sets. Using latent class analysis, we evaluated whether criteria composing the measure aggregate into a syndrome. We verified the criterion validity of the measure by testing whether participants defined as frail were more likely than others to develop adverse geriatric outcomes or to die. Results The distributions of frailty in the WHAS and CHS were comparable. In latent class analyses, the measures demonstrated strong internal validity vis a vis stated theory characterizing frailty as a medical syndrome. In proportional hazards models, frail women had a higher risk of developing activities of daily living (ADL) and/or instrumental ADL Disability, institutionalization, and death, independently of multiple potentially confounding factors. Conclusions The findings of this study are consistent with the widely held theory that conceptualizes frailty as a syndrome. The frailty definition developed in the CHS is applicable across diverse population samples and identifies a profile of high risk of multiple adverse outcomes.

Age and Ageing, 2017Co-Authors: Vasant Hirani, Vasi Naganathan, Fiona M Blyth, David Le G Couteur, Markus J Seibel, Louise M Waite, David J Handelsman, Robert G CummingAbstract:Background: to explore the longitudinal associations between body composition measures, sarcopenic obesity and outcomes of frailty, activities of daily living (ADL) and instrumental ADL (IADL) Disability, institutionalisation and mortality. Methods: men aged ≥ 70 years (2005-07) from the Concord Health and Ageing in Men Project were assessed at baseline (n = 1,705), 2 (n = 1,366) and 5 years (n = 954). The main outcome measures were frailty (adapted Fried criteria), ADL, including personal care and mobility and IADL Disability (ability to perform tasks for independent living), institutionalisation and mortality. The Foundation for the National Institutes of Health cut-points were used for low muscle mass: appendicular lean mass (ALM):Body Mass Index (BMI) ratio (ALMBMI) 30% fat. Generalised estimating equations were used to examine the longitudinal associations between the independent variables (obesity alone, low muscle mass and sarcopenic obesity) and frailty, ADL and IADL Disability. Results: in unadjusted, age adjusted and fully adjusted analysis, men with low muscle mass showed increased risk of frailty and IADL Disability. In fully adjusted analysis, men with sarcopenic obesity had an increased risk of frailty (odds ratio (OR): 2.00 (95% confidence of interval (CI): 1.42, 2.82)) ADL Disability (OR: 1.58 (95% CI: 1.12, 2.24)) and IADL Disability (OR: 1.36 (95% CI: 1.05, 1.76)). Obesity alone was protective for institutionalisation (OR: 0.51 (95% CI: 0.31, 0.84)) but was not associated with any other outcomes. Conclusions: low muscle mass and sarcopenic obesity were associated with poor functional outcomes, independent of confounders. This would suggest that future trials on frailty and Disability prevention should be designed to intervene on both muscle mass and fat mass.

Journal of the American Medical Directors Association, 2015Co-Authors: Robert G Cumming, Vasi Naganathan, Vasant Hirani, Fiona M Blyth, David Le G Couteur, Markus J Seibel, Louise M Waite, David J HandelsmanAbstract:Introduction: Sarcopenia is associated with an increased risk of adverse outcomes. The aim of this study was to explore the relationship between severity of sarcopenia and incident activities of daily living (ADL) Disability, institutionalization, and all-cause mortality among community-dwelling older men participating in the Concord Health and Ageing in Men Project (CHAMP). Methods: Longitudinal analysis of 1705 participants aged 70 years or older at baseline (2005e2007) living in the community in Sydney, Australia. Measurements: The main outcome measures were incident ADL Disability, institutionalization, and mortality. Of the 1705 participants who completed the baseline assessments, a total of 1678 men (mean age 77 years) had complete measures by dual-energy x-ray absorptiometry, to assess sarcopenia in terms of low appendicular lean mass (ALM), using the Foundation for the National Institutes of Health (FNIH) criteria. To differentiate between severity of sarcopenia we used low ALM alone (sarcopenia I), low ALM with weakness (sarcopenia II), and sarcopenia with weakness and poor gait speed (sarcopenia III). Cox proportional hazard models and logistic regression models were used to assess the risk of mortality and institutionalization, and incidence of ADL Disability. Results: From baseline to follow-up, 103 (11.3%) men had incident ADL Disability, 191 (11.2%) men were institutionalized, and 535 (31.9%) had died. At baseline,14.2% had sarcopenia I, 5.3% had sarcopenia II, and 3.7% had sarcopenia III. Fully adjusted analysis (adjusted for demographics, lifestyle factors, comorbidities and health conditions, and blood measures) showed that sarcopenia I, II, and III were associated with increased risk of Disability, institutionalization, and mortality. Associations between sarcopenia I, II, and III and risk of incident Disability were as follows: odds ratio (OR) 2.77 95% confidence interval (CI) 1.30e5.87, OR 3.78 95% CI 1.23e11.64, and OR 4.53 95% CI 0.90e22.72; associations with institutionalization were hazard ratio (HR) 1.96 95% CI 1.14e3.35, HR 2.53 95% CI 1.31e4.90, and HR 2.27 95% CI 1.08e4.80; and with mortality were HR 1.65 95% CI 1.30e2.09, HR 1.50 95% CI 1.08e2.08, and HR 1.69 95% CI 1.17e2.44.

BMC Public Health, 2010Co-Authors: Noran Naqiah Hairi, Robert G Cumming, Vasi Naganathan, Awang Bulgiba, Izzuna MudlaAbstract:The prevalence and correlates of physical Disability and functional limitation among older people have been studied in many developed countries but not in a middle income country such as Malaysia. The present study investigated the epidemiology of physical Disability and functional limitation among older people in Malaysia and compares findings to other countries. A population-based cross sectional study was conducted in Alor Gajah, Malacca. Seven hundred and sixty five older people aged 60 years and above underwent tests of functional limitation (Tinetti Performance Oriented Mobility Assessment Tool). Data were also collected for self reported activities of daily living (ADL) using the Barthel Index (ten items). To compare prevalence with other studies, ADL Disability was also defined using six basic ADL's (eating, bathing, dressing, transferring, toileting and walking) and five basic ADL's (eating, bathing, dressing, transferring and toileting). Ten, six and five basic ADL Disability was reported by 24.7% (95% CI 21.6-27.9), 14.4% (95% CI 11.9-17.2) and 10.6% (95% CI 8.5-13.1), respectively. Functional limitation was found in 19.5% (95% CI 16.8-22.5) of participants. Variables independently associated with 10 item ADL Disability physical Disability, were advanced age (≥ 75 years: prevalence ratio (PR) 7.9; 95% CI 4.8-12.9), presence of diabetes (PR 1.8; 95% CI 1.4-2.3), stroke (PR 1.5; 95% CI 1.1-2.2), depressive symptomology (PR 1.3; 95% CI 1.1-1.8) and visual impairment (blind: PR 2.0; 95% CI 1.1-3.6). Advancing age (≥ 75 years: PR 3.0; 95% CI 1.7-5.2) being female (PR 2.7; 95% CI 1.2-6.1), presence of arthritis (PR 1.6; 95% CI 1.2-2.1) and depressive symptomology (PR 2.0; 95% CI 1.5-2.7) were significantly associated with functional limitation. The prevalence of physical Disability and functional limitation among older Malaysians appears to be much higher than in developed countries but is comparable to developing countries. Associations with socio-demographic and other health related variables were consistent with other studies.

Journal of the American Geriatrics Society, 2006Co-Authors: Jama L Purser, Gerda G Fillenbaum, Robert B WallaceAbstract:OBJECTIVES: To evaluate the prevalence and utility of memory complaint in a geographically representative cohort and, in cases with mild cognitive impairment (MCI), to determine whether memory complaint alters 10-year trajectories of Disability in activities of daily living (ADLs), Short Portable Mental Status Questionnaire (SPMSQ) score, and 20-item word recall. DESIGN: Prospective cohort study. SETTING: Washington and Iowa counties, Iowa. PARTICIPANTS: Iowa Established Populations for Epidemiologic Studies of the Elderly (N=3,673; aged ≥65; 61.3% female; 99.9% white). MEASUREMENTS: Age, sex, education, SPMSQ score, 20-item word recall, ADL or instrumental ADL Disability, and chronic medical conditions. RESULTS: The prevalence of memory complaint was 34%. Although proportionally more cognitively impaired individuals were in the memory complaint group (34% vs 27%), the pattern of subclassification into cognitively intact and MCI Stage 1 and 2 subgroups was similar for people with and without memory complaint. Median SPMSQ score and number of words recalled at baseline were comparable across memory complaint categories in each subgroup. MCI participants without subjective memory complaint constituted a larger proportion of the overall sample than individuals with subjective memory complaint (460 (14%) vs 295 (8.9%)) and of persons objectively classified as having MCI (61% vs 39%). The distribution of individual 10-year change in ADL Disability, SPMSQ score, and word recall were similar for those with and without memory complaint across all subgroups of cognitive impairment. CONCLUSION: Memory complaint is not necessary for MCI diagnosis and does not distinguish cases with different progression rates in Disability or cognitive impairment. 2006.

Journal of the American Geriatrics Society, 2005Co-Authors: Jama L Purser, Gerda G Fillenbaum, Carl F Pieper, Robert B WallaceAbstract:Objectives: To apply diagnostic criteria for mild cognitive impairment (MCI) to a geographically representative sample, to estimate the prevalence of MCI, and to estimate 10-year trajectories of incident Disability for cognitively intact participants and subgroups with MCI. Design: Prospective cohort; 10 years of follow-up. Setting: Community-based survey of noninstitutionalized population aged 65 and or older in two rural Iowa counties (Washington and Iowa). Participants: Iowa Established Populations for Epidemiologic Studies of the Elderly (aged ≥65; N=3,673; 61.3% female; 99.9% white). Measurements: Age, sex, education, Short Portable Mental Status Questionnaire (SPMSQ), 20-item word recall, activities of daily living (ADLs), instrumental activities of daily living (IADLs), chronic medical conditions. Results: MCI was prevalent in 24.7% of participants at baseline. Most participants in the overall cohort remained stable or changed slowly (≤1 new limitations) over 10 years (63.1% for SPMSQ, 89.3% for word recall, and 61.7% for ADL Disability). For MCI/no prevalent IADL Disability (Stage 1 MCI), Disability progression was similar to that in the cognitively intact subgroup (median=0.08 vs 0.05 disabilities per year). For MCI plus prevalent IADL Disability (Stage 2 MCI), the median rate of change was equivalent to that of the severely impaired (0.23 disabilities per year; interquartile range=0.12–0.36). Conclusion: Unlike participants with MCI who reported no IADL limitations, those with such limitations were more likely to develop ADL Disability—a prerequisite for a diagnosis of dementia.

Although it has been demonstrated that physical performance measures predict incident Disability in previously nondisabled older persons, the available data have not been fully developed to create usable methods for determining risk profiles in community-dwelling populations. Using several populations and different follow-up periods, this study replicates previous findings by using the Established Populations for the Epidemiologic Study of the Elderly (EPESE) performance battery and provides equations for the prediction of Disability risk according to age, sex, and level of performance. Methods. Tests of balance, time to walk 8 ft, and time to rise from a chair 5 times were administered to 4,588 initially nondisabled persons in the four sites of the EPESE and to 1,946 initially nondisabled persons in the Hispanic EPESE. Follow-up assessment for activity of daily living (ADL) and mobility-related Disability occurred from 1 to 6 years later. Results. In the EPESE, compared with those with the best performance (EPESE summary performance score of 10‐ 12), the relative risks of mobility-related Disability for those with scores of 4‐6 ranged from 2.9 to 4.9 and the relative risk of Disability for those with scores of 7‐9 ranged from 1.5 to 2.1, with similar consistent results for ADL Disability. The observed rates of incident Disability according to performance level in the Hispanic EPESE agreed closely with rates predicted from models developed from the EPESE sites. Receiver operating characteristic curves showed that gait speed alone performed almost as well as the full battery in predicting incident Disability. Conclusions. Performance tests of lower extremity function accurately predict Disability across diverse populations. Equations derived from models using both the summary score and the gait speed alone allow for the estimation of risk of Disability in community-dwelling populations and provide valuable information for estimating sample size for clinical trials of Disability prevention.

Guralnik, Brenda W J H Penninx, Marco Pahor, Maria Chiara Corti, Robert B Wallace, Harvey J Cohen, Tamara B Harris, Russell P Tracy, Richard J HavlikAbstract:BACKGROUND: The serum concentration of interleukin 6 (IL-6), a cytokine that plays a central role in inflammation, increases with age. Because inflammation is a component of many age-associated chronic diseases, which often cause Disability, high circulating levels of IL-6 may contribute to functional decline in old age. We tested the hypothesis that high levels of IL-6 predict future Disability in older persons who are not disabled. METHODS: Participants at the sixth annual follow-up of the Iowa site of the Established Populations for Epidemiologic Studies of the Elderly aged 71 years or older were considered eligible for this study if they had no Disability in regard to mobility or in selected activities of daily living (ADL), and they were re-interviewed 4 years later. Incident cases of mobility-Disability and of ADL-Disability were identified based on responses at the follow-up interview. Measures of IL-6 were obtained from specimens collected at baseline from the 283 participants who developed any Disability and from 350 participants selected randomly (46.9%) from those who continued to be non-disabled. FINDINGS: Participants in the highest IL-6 tertile were 1.76 (95% CI, 1.17-2.64) times more likely to develop at least mobility-Disability and 1.62 (95% CI, 1.02-2.60) times more likely to develop mobility plus ADL-Disability compared with to the lowest IL-6 tertile. The strength of this association was almost unchanged after adjusting for multiple confounders. The increased risk of mobility-Disability over the full spectrum of IL-6 concentration was nonlinear, with the risk rising rapidly beyond plasma levels of 2.5 pg/mL. INTERPRETATION: Higher circulating levels of IL-6 predict Disability onset in older persons. This may be attributable to a direct effect of IL-6 on muscle atrophy and/or to the pathophysiologic role played by IL-6 in specific diseases. J Am Geriatr Soc 47:639–646, 1999.

Journal of Aging and Health, 2017Co-Authors: Brian Downer, Michael Crowe, Kyriakos S MarkidesAbstract:Objective: To examine the development of activities of daily living (ADL) Disability and mortality according to diabetes and high depressive symptoms among Puerto Rican adults aged 60 and older. Method: Data came from Wave I and Wave II of the Puerto Rican Elderly: Health Conditions Study (n = 3,419). Logistic regression was used. Using insulin and receiving psychiatric treatment were proxy measures of disease severity for diabetes and depressive symptoms, respectively. Results: High depressive symptoms at baseline were associated with developing ADL Disability (OR = 2.21; 95% CI = [1.68, 2.91]). Diabetes at baseline was associated with mortality at follow-up (OR = 1.72; 95% CI = [1.34, 2.19]). Baseline diabetes was associated with developing ADL Disability but only for those who reported using insulin (OR = 1.69; 95% CI = [1.08, 2.61]). Journal of the American Geriatrics Society, 2005Co-Authors: Mukaila A Raji, Kyriakos S Markides, Soham Al Snih Al Snih, Yong Fang Kuo, Kristen M Peek, Kenneth J OttenbacherAbstract:Objectives: To examine the association between Mini-Mental State Examination (MMSE) score and subsequent muscle strength (measured using handgrip strength) and to test the hypothesis that muscle strength will mediate any association between impaired cognition and incident activity of daily living (ADL) Disability over a 7-year period in elderly Mexican Americans who were initially not disabled. Design: A 7-year prospective cohort study (1993–2001). Setting: Five southwestern states (Texas, New Mexico, Colorado, Arizona, and California). Participants: Two thousand three hundred eighty-one noninstitutionalized Mexican-American men and women aged 65 and older with no ADL Disability at baseline. Measurements: In-home interviews in 1993/1994, 1995/1996, 1998/1999, and 2000/2001 assessed social and demographic factors, medical conditions (diabetes mellitus, stroke, heart attack, and arthritis), body mass index (BMI), depressive symptomatology, handgrip muscle strength, and ADLs. MMSE score was dichotomized as less than 21 for poor cognition and 21 or greater for good cognition. Main outcomes measures were mean and slope of handgrip muscle strength over the 7-year period and incident Disability, defined as new onset of any ADL limitation at the 2-, 5-, or 7-year follow-up interview periods. Results: In mixed model analyses, there was a significant cross-sectional association between having poor cognition (MMSE<21) and lower handgrip strength, independent of age, sex, and time of interview (estimate=−1.41, standard error (SE)=0.18; P<.001). With the introduction of a cognition-by-time interaction term into the model, there was also a longitudinal association between poor cognition and change in handgrip strength over time (estimate=−0.25, SE=0.06; P<.001), indicating that subjects with poor cognition had a significantly greater decline in handgrip strength over 7 years than those with good cognition, independent of age, sex, and time. This longitudinal association between poor cognition and greater muscle decline remained significant (P<.001) after controlling for age, sex, education, and time-dependent variables of depression, BMI, and medical conditions. In general estimation equation models, having poor cognition was associated with greater risk of 7-year incident ADL Disability (odds ratio=2.01, 95% confidence interval (CI)=1.60–2.52); the magnitude of the association decreased to 1.66 (95% CI=1.31–2.10) when adjustment was made for handgrip strength. Conclusion: Older Mexican Americans with poor cognition had steeper decline in handgrip muscle strength over 7 years than those with good cognition, independent of other demographic and health factors. A possible mediating effect of muscle strength on the association between poor cognition and subsequent ADL Disability was also indicated.

Aging Clinical and Experimental Research, 2004Co-Authors: Soham Al Snih Al Snih, Kyriakos S Markides, Kenneth J Ottenbacher, Mukaila A RajiAbstract:Background and aims: Little is known about muscle strength as a predictor of Disability among older Mexican Americans. The aim of this study was to examine the association between hand grip strength and 7-year incidence of ADL Disability in older Mexican American men and women. Methods: A 7-year prospective cohort study of 2493 non-institutionalized Mexican American men and women aged 65 or older residing in five south-western states. Maximal hand grip strength test, body mass index, cognitive function, activities of daily living, self-reports of medical conditions (arthritis, diabetes, heart attack, stroke, cancer, hip fracture), and depressive symptoms were obtained. Results: In a Cox proportional regression analysis, there was a linear relationship between hand grip strength at baseline and risk of incident ADL Disability over a 7-year follow-up. Among non-disabled men at baseline, the hazard ratio of any new ADL limitation was 1.90(95% CI 1.14–3.17) for those in the lowest quartile, when compared with men in the highest hand grip strength quartile, after controlling for age, marital status, medical conditions, high depressive symptoms, MMSE score, and BMI at baseline. Among non-disabled women at baseline, the hazard ratio of any new ADL limitation was 2.28 (95% CI 1.59–3.27) for those in the lowest quartile, when compared with women in the highest hand grip strength quartile. Conclusions: Hand grip strength is an independent predictor of ADL Disability among older Mexican American men and women. The hand grip strength test is an easy, reliable, valid, inexpensive method of screening to identify older adults at risk of Disability.

Journals of Gerontology Series A-biological Sciences and Medical Sciences, 2021Co-Authors: Peggy M Cawthon, Terri Blackwell, Steven R Cummings, Eric S Orwoll, Kate Duchowny, Deborah M Kado, Katie L Stone, Kristine E EnsrudAbstract:BACKGROUND Whether low muscle mass is a risk factor for Disability and mortality is unclear. Associations between approximations of muscle mass (including lean mass from dual-energy x-ray absorptiometry [DXA]), and these outcomes are inconsistent. METHODS Muscle mass measured by deuterated creatine (D3Cr) dilution and appendicular lean mass (ALM, by DXA) were assessed at the Year 14 Visit (2014-2016) of the prospective Osteoporotic Fractures in Men study (N = 1,425, age 77-101 years). Disability in activities of daily living (ADLs), instrumental ADLs, and mobility tasks was self-reported at the Year 14 visit and 2.2 years later; deaths were centrally adjudicated over 3.3 years. Relative risks and 95% confidence intervals (CI) were estimated per standard deviation decrement with negative binomial, logistic regression, or proportional hazards models. RESULTS In age- and clinical center-adjusted models, the relative risks per decrement in D3Cr muscle mass/wgt was 1.9 (95% CI: 1.2, 3.1) for incident self-reported ADL Disability; 1.5 (95% CI: 1.3, 1.9) for instrumental ADL Disability; and 1.8 (95% CI: 1.5, 2.2) for mobility Disability. In age-, clinical center-, and weight-adjusted models, the relative risks per decrement in D3Cr muscle mass was 1.8 (95% CI: 1.5, 2.2) for all-cause mortality. In contrast, lower DXA ALM was not associated with any outcome. Associations of D3Cr muscle mass with these outcomes were slightly attenuated after adjustment for confounding factors and the potentially mediating effects of strength and physical performance. CONCLUSIONS Low muscle mass as measured by D3Cr dilution is a novel risk factor for clinically meaningful outcomes in older men.
